Welcome boxer and senior dog lovers! This handsome, salt-and-pepper fellow is Pierre, a 9-year old boxer patiently waiting for someone to love and share his golden years with in his forever home. Pierre is a people-oriented guy and adores his humans. While he is living in a multi-dog foster home and has made several canine friends there, he would very much enjoy being the center of attention as an only dog in his forever home. When he came to the rescue, Pierre was a bit frail and underweight. As his weight, muscle tone, and overall health improved, so did his strength. He is in excellent condition and health for a dog in his season of life. Pierre walks well on leash and also enjoys moderate hikes. He adores a good car ride, snuggles on the couch, or just chilling on the floor while the humans do their thing. Pierre is crate-trained and rests nicely in crate when his foster family is at work. Pierre would benefit from a schedule where he can have pottery breaks during the day. He would be excellent for someone who has a flexible schedule. Pierre is microchipped, up-to-date on vaccinations, is on tick/heartworm preventatives. He had senior bloodwork done before receiving a dental to freshen up that cute mouth of his.
